//------------------------------------------------
//--- 010 Editor v12.0 Binary Template
//
// File: smtv--tbcr.bt
// Authors: lipsum, DeathChaos, Sierra, Tildehat
// Version: 0.1
// Purpose: Parses SMTV TBCR *.uexp files
// Category: Game
// File Mask: *.uexp
// ID Bytes:
// History:
//------------------------------------------------
#include "formats/smtv_enums.h"
/* Each file format is included in its own .h file */
#include "formats/NKMBaseTable.h"
#include "formats/SkillData.h"
#include "formats/EncountData.h"
#include "formats/UniteTable.h"
#include "formats/PlayerGrow.h"
/* Table */
typedef struct ( int size )
{
local int entry_index = entry_count++;
SetBackColor( cLtGreen - 0x002200 * ( entry_index % 2 ) );
local string tbl_id;
SPrintf( tbl_id, "%s%d", base_name, table_index );
switch ( tbl_id )
{
case "PlayerGrow0": PlayerGrow0 data; break;
case "NKMBaseTable0": NKMBaseTable0 data; break;
case "NKMBaseTable1": NKMBaseTable1 data; break;
case "SkillData0": SkillData0 data; break;
case "UniteTable1": UniteTable1 data; break;
case "EncountData0": EncountData0 data; break;
case "EncountData1": EncountData1 data; break;
default: byte data[ size ]; break;
}
FSeek( startof( this ) + size );
} TBL1Entry <optimize=false, read=TBL1Entry_Read>;
string TBL1Entry_Read( TBL1Entry &o )
{
local string s;
switch ( o.tbl_id )
{
case "PlayerGrow0": s = PlayerGrow0_Read( o.data ); break;
case "NKMBaseTable0": s = NKMBaseTable0_Read( o.data ); break;
case "NKMBaseTable1": s = NKMBaseTable1_Read( o.data ); break;
case "SkillData0": s = SkillData0_Read( o.data ); break;
case "UniteTable1": s = UniteTable1_Read( o.data ); break;
case "EncountData0": s = EncountData0_Read( o.data ); break;
case "EncountData1": s = EncountData1_Read( o.data ); break;
}
return s;
}
typedef struct
{
local int table_index = tbl_count++;
local int entry_count = 0;
SetBackColor( cLtYellow - 0x002200 * ( table_index % 2 ) );
int offset;
SetBackColor( cPurple );
local int seek_back = FTell();
FSeek( 0x25 + header_size + offset ); // parent (tbcr) header_size
char magic[ 4 ];
int data_size;
int entry_size;
int header_size; // guess - always 16? alignment?
if ( data_size )
{
TBL1Entry entries( entry_size )[ data_size / entry_size ];
}
FSeek( seek_back );
} TBL1 <optimize=false, read=Str( "%s: %d entries (0x%X)",
this.magic, this.data_size / this.entry_size, this.entry_size )>;
typedef struct
{
local int tbl_count = 0;
SetBackColor( cLtBlue );
char magic[ 4 ] <bgcolor=cRed>;
int header_size; // with magic
int table_count;
TBL1 tables[ table_count ];
} TBCR <optimize=false, read=Str( "%s: %d tables", this.magic, this.table_count )>;
/* --- */
local string file_name = GetFileName();
local string base_name = FileNameGetBase( file_name, false );
Printf( "%s\n", base_name );
LittleEndian();
byte uexp_header[ 0x21 ] <hidden=true>;
int coll_size <hidden=true>;
TBCR table_coll;
FSeek( 0x21 + coll_size );
byte uexp_footer[ FileSize() - FTell() ] <hidden=true>;
